The 
serum levels of adinazolam, 
alprazolam, chlordiazepoxide, clobazam, clorazepate, 
diazepam, flurazepam, nitrazepam, 
triazolam, 
zaleplon, 
zolpidem (and probably halazepam and prazepam) are raised by 
cimetidine, but normally this appears to be of little or no 
clinical importance, and only the occasional patient may experience an 
 increase in effects (sedation). Clotiazepam, 
lorazepam, lormetazepam, 
oxazepam and 
temazepam are not normally affected by 
cimetidine. Famotidine, 
nizatidine and ranitidine do not interact with most benzodiazepines, except possibly 
triazolam. The picture with 
midazolam is somewhat confused. 
 In general no clinically significant interaction occurs, but note that individual patients may rarely experience increased sedation.
